  • Applications

    Dibutyl suberate is used primarily as a diester plasticizer for PVC, nitrocellulose, ethyl cellulose, acrylics and selected synthetic rubbers, providing durable flexibility, good low-temperature performance, a lowered brittle point, improved clarity, and resistance to checking; thanks to its low viscosity, very low pour point and good boundary lubrication, it also serves as a base-stock component or viscosity trimmer in synthetic ester lubricants (e.g., compressor oils, precision instruments, light gear oils), as a cold-start improver and friction reducer; additionally it functions as a solvent/modifier in printing inks, coatings and nitrocellulose lacquers to enhance flow, adhesion and crack resistance, and as a carrier for dyes; it may occasionally appear in personal-care formulations as an emollient or fragrance carrier (subject to local regulations), and as an intermediate in synthesis, fitting formulations that require low odor, low volatility, biodegradability and broad polymer compatibility, with attention to hydrolytic stability.
